The OpenNET Project / Index page

[ новости /+++ | форум | wiki | теги | ]

Выпуск интегрированной среды разработки Apache NetBeans 12.3

11.03.2021 17:00

Организации Apache Software Foundation представила интегрированную среду разработки Apache NetBeans 12.3, которая предоставляет поддержку языков программирования Java SE, Java EE, PHP, C/C++, JavaScript и Groovy. Это седьмой релиз, подготовленный Фондом Apache после передачи кода NetBeans компанией Oracle.

Основные новшества NetBeans 12.3:

  • В средствах разработки на языке Java применение LSP-сервера (Language Server Protocol) расширено для операций переименования при рефакторинге, сворачивания блоков в коде, выявления ошибок в коде и генерации кода. Добавлено отображение JavaDoc при наведении курсора на идентификаторы.
  • Встроенный в NetBeans Java-компилятор nb-javac (модифицированный javac) обновлён до nbjavac 15.0.0.2, распространяемого через Maven. Добавлены тесты для JDK 15.
  • Улучшено отображения подпроектов в больших проектах Gradle. В Gradle Navigator добавлена секция избранных задач (Favorite tasks).
  • Реализована полная поддержки синтаксиса PHP 8, но ещё не готово автодополнение атрибутов и именованных параметров. В строку состояния добавлена кнопка для изменения используемой в проекте версии PHP. Улучшена поддержка пакетов Composer. Расширены возможности работы с точками останова в отладчике.
  • Продолжено развитие C++ Lite, упрощённого режима для разработки на языках C/C++. Добавлен отладчик с поддержкой точек останова, потоков, переменных, всплывающих подсказок и т.п.
  • Обновлены версии FlatLaf 1.0, Groovy 2.5.14, JAXB 2.3, JGit 5.7.0, Metro 2.4.4, JUnit 4.13.1.
  • Проведена общая чистка кода.


  1. Главная ссылка к новости (https://blogs.apache.org/netbe...)
  2. OpenNews: Выпуск интегрированной среды разработки Apache NetBeans 12.2
  3. OpenNews: Выпуск интегрированной среды разработки Apache NetBeans 12.1
  4. OpenNews: Вредоносное ПО, поражающее NetBeans для внедрения бэкдоров в собираемые проекты
  5. OpenNews: Выпуск интегрированной среды разработки Apache NetBeans 12.0
  6. OpenNews: Уязвимости в механизме автообновления Apache NetBeans
Лицензия: CC-BY
Тип: Программы
Короткая ссылка: https://opennet.ru/54739-netbeans
Ключевые слова: netbeans
Поддержать дальнейшую публикацию новостей на OpenNET.


Обсуждение (51) Ajax | 1 уровень | Линейный | +/- | Раскрыть всё | RSS
  • 1.1, ДмитрийСССР (?), 17:04, 11/03/2021 [ответить] [﹢﹢﹢] [ · · · ]  
  • –4 +/
    Скромненько :( Не догонят так JetBrains
     
     
  • 2.2, Аноним (2), 17:11,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+11 +/
    Официальный ответ JetBrains: Небо уронит ночь на ладони.
     
  • 2.10, Аноним (10), 18:20,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+2 +/
    И не нужно
     
     
  • 3.17, Леголас (ok), 18:50,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+1 +/
    верно, апачи презирают конкуренцию в частности и все творения бледнолицых в общности
     

  • 1.3, Аноним (3), 17:17, 11/03/2021 Скрыто модератором [﹢﹢﹢] [ · · · ]
  • +/
     
     
  • 2.4, Qwerty (??), 17:19, 11/03/2021 Скрыто модератором
  • –3 +/
     
     
  • 3.22, Последний из могикан (?), 19:10, 11/03/2021 Скрыто модератором
  • –1 +/
     

     ....ответы скрыты модератором (2)

  • 1.5, Аноним (5), 17:30, 11/03/2021 [ответить] [﹢﹢﹢] [ · · · ]  
  • –12 +/
    После семейства сред разработки IntelliJ IDEA все вокруг кажется лишь примитивными нотепад.экзешками.
     
     
  • 2.6, Аноним (6), 17:37,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+13 +/
    > IntelliJ IDEA

    В упор не понимаю, кто этим пользуется.

     
     
  • 3.7, Аноним (5), 17:42,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• –10 +/
    > В упор не понимаю

    Ооо, сынок, тебе еще много чего предстоит понять.

     
     
  • 4.8, Аноним (-), 17:51,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+2 +/
    Лууууул, жабист называет всех сынками т.к автокомплит в его любимой иде лучше автокомплита в X иде. Капецнадожилиля
     
     
  • 5.9, Аноним (5), 17:58,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• –1 +/
    Автокомплит -- далеко не единственная фича. IDEA формирует PSI-представление для любого проекта, что дает широчайшие возможности для рефакторинга. Например, есть ли в твоей "X иде" возможность структурного поиска? https://www.jetbrains.com/help/idea/2020.3/search-templates.html
     
     
  • 6.13, клавиатура (?), 18:37,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• –5 +/
    Как там с мега рефакторингом дела?
    Пишешь настолько безграмотный код, что приходится мощно рефакторить?
    Грамотные разрабы пишут сразу грамотный код, тебе видать пока не дано, раз нужна помошь в искусственного интелекта разгребать твой мусор.
    Поделись с нами.
     
     
  • 7.15, Аноним (5), 18:45,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    Ты исходишь из ложной предпосылки, будто программы пишутся по единожды сформированным ндцать лет назад требованиям.
     
     
  • 8.20, клавиатура (?), 18:56,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• –2 +/
    Не надо демагогии с якобы умными словами и домыслами Тебе написали, то что напи... текст свёрнут, показать
     
     
  • 9.23, Аноним (5), 19:13,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• –1 +/
    То есть разработчик ни в коем случае не должен изучать собственные инструменты р... текст свёрнут, показать
     
     
  • 10.34, клавиатура (?), 19:47,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    Почему тебя понесло в крайность Пишешь о том как вручную без IDE создавать клас... текст свёрнут, показать
     
     
  • 11.35, Аноним (5), 19:52,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• –2 +/
    Нет, это то, что ты придумал и приписал мне, чтобы было легче опровергать Данны... текст свёрнут, показать
     
     
  • 12.37, клавиатура (?), 20:01,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+1 +/
    Что ты там рефакторишь днями и ночами понятия не имею Доказывай себе сам, что у... текст свёрнут, показать
     
     
  • 13.42, Sw00p aka Jerom (?), 21:20,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• –1 +/
    Рефакторят от части чужой код, а сравнивать иде нет смысла, для кого-то идеX удо... текст свёрнут, показать
     
  • 6.18, Аноним (18), 18:52,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• –2 +/
    Хрень какая-то. Мне для реализации всех даже самых извращенных фантазий достаточно nano.
    Рефакторинг - о, да. Достойное занятие. А что мешает писать сразу правильно? Аджайл? Канбан?
     
     
  • 7.25, Аноним (5), 19:22,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    > достаточно nano

    Для проектов с двумя-тремя питоноскриптами в 20 строк одного nano действительно будет достаточно.

    > Рефакторинг - о, да. Достойное занятие. А что мешает писать сразу правильно? Аджайл? Канбан?

    В контексте IDE, рефакторинг - абсолютно любая автоматизированная операция над кодом. Включая переименование переменной. Когда дорастешь до проектов, где одного nano недостаточно, узнаешь о том, что рефакторить оказывается можно не только свой код, потому что над проектом работает целая команда.

     
     
  • 8.28, Аноним (18), 19:33,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    Да я как бы уже их перерос Ну нафиг А замену по всем файлам - так это и до мен... текст свёрнут, показать
     
  • 6.27, Аноним (27), 19:28,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• –1 +/
    Могу разве что посоветовать научиться программировать.
     
     
  • 7.31, Аноним (5), 19:44,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    Научись, давно пора.
     
  • 3.48, iPony129412 (?), 09:44, 12/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    IntelliJ — это прям самые фапабельные IDE, которые могут быть.
    Но если чего не понимаешь — ну бывает...
     
     
  • 4.50, Аноним (50), 00:39, 15/03/2021 [^] [^^] [^^^] [ответить]  
  • –1 +/
    клозет сорец какбе, но ты даже этого не знаешь
     
     
  • 5.51, iPony129412 (?), 05:16, 15/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    > клозет сорец какбе

    да как-то всё равно

     
  • 2.24, barmaglot (??), 19:16,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    А его нет на халяву и для C++.
    Я вот на C++ для души пишу, и NetBeans, до сих пор лучшая бесплатная IDE для C++, несмотря на отсутствие полноценний поддержки C++17 и 20.
    Т.е. я за свою графоманию денег не получаю, а деньги семьи на хобби не трачу. Т.е. для меня это идеальный вариант.
     
     
  • 3.26, Аноним (5), 19:25,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• –4 +/
    CLion бесплатен, если качать не релиз, а свежачок из early access program.
     
  • 3.30, barmaglot (??), 19:38,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    Забираю свои слова обратно [^U для всего предыдущего сообщения]
    Факт: 12.3 говно. C++ Lite говно. Поддержки старого плагина 8.1 больше нет. Старые проекты не поддерживаются. Подсветка синтаксиса убита. В 3.14зду такой IDE.
    Откатился на 12.0 ... буду пробовать Clion как вот выше советуют. Но если там настройка форматирования такое-же говно как в Eclipse, то так и останусь на старье ...
     
     
  • 4.32, Аноним (32), 19:44,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+1 +/
    Припоминаю, что kdevelop был лучше всех, возможно, стоит попробовать вместо всей этой дряни.
     
  • 4.33, Аноним (-), 19:45,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    Полностью согласен, убили работающую систему на убогую подделку, которую никогда не доделают.
     
  • 4.39, Аноним (6), 20:11,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    >буду пробовать Clion как вот выше советуют

    Не ведитесь вы на их впаривания

     
  • 4.47, Аноним (47), 02:32, 12/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    скорее всего поправят. У меня отваливался плагин для C++ и на 12, потом на 12.1, потом на 12.2. Через какое-то время что-то правили и оно начинало работать.
     
  • 3.38, Аноним (6), 20:06,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+1 +/
    Если нужна именно IDE — бери Qt Creator.
     
     
  • 4.49, Аноним (49), 23:46, 14/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    Qt Creator это RAD, а не какой то там IDE тобишь продвинутый текстовый редактор с автодополнением и подсветкой
     
  • 2.40, Аноним (40), 20:23,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• –1 +/
    Софт по подписке только для тех, кто на нем зарабатывает.
     

  • 1.11, Аноним (32), 18:26, 11/03/2021 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    Я на той неделе пытался использовать, чтобы подцепить проект на жава. Так и не смог настроить линковку зависимостей, как ни пытался. С эклипсом кстати пусть и через одно место, но получилось накрутить, и гораздо меньше времени ушло. А ещё без интернета устанавливать компоненты нетбинса слишком уж сомнительная движуха, в эклипсе всё необходимое сразу было и компоненты без проблем цеплялись.
     
     
  • 2.14, Аноним (32), 18:42,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    Из консоли вообще не понял как собирать. Вот есть проект, я смотрю импорты и собираю все зависимости в кучу. В итоге всё равно что-то компилируется, но там где зависимости нет, естественно в jar ничего не собрать (можно собрать исходники, но они не запускаются потом) и не скажет что ей не так. В эклипсе впрочем тоже скомпилированный jar собрать не получилось, только так запускать прямо из него. Дичь какая-то эта жава, ещё и javafx отдельная развлекуха (а оракловский не скачать больше).
     
     
  • 3.16, клавиатура (?), 18:48,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    Обычно среднестатистический стедент это осиливает, особенно когда под рукой есть интернет.
     
     
  • 4.19, Аноним (32), 18:56,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    Я много времени потратил на это, так и не получилось. Намного больше, чем можно оправдать. Это в эклипсе нажал добавить из гита и у тебя готовый проект и дальше собирай не хочу, но если это кучка не связанных файлов всё уже не так просто. Наверное, от качества проекта тоже зависит.
     
  • 3.43, Жавабог (?), 21:28,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• –1 +/
    Мавен?
    Нет не слышали
     
     
  • 4.45, Аноним (32), 23:14,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    Из мавена и скачивал (странная вещь почему java ide для java не может работать с java кодом из коробки), но сборке это не помогло.
     
  • 2.21, Аноним (21), 19:02,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    Простите, кто на ком стоял?
     

  • 1.12, клавиатура (?), 18:31, 11/03/2021 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    Кто-нибудь пробовал Eclipse Che?
    Какие впечатления?
     
     
  • 2.29, Аноним (-), 19:37,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    У еклипса два положения : смотришь код с подсветкой или пишешь код без подсветки, в остальных случаях он тормозит
     
     
  • 3.36, клавиатура (?), 19:54,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    Тебе не хватает внимания?
     

  • 1.41, Аноним (41), 20:44, 11/03/2021 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    > Apache NetBeans 12.3 Ссылка ведёт на Not Found
     
     
  • 2.44, Аноним (-), 22:09, 11/03/2021 [^] [^^] [^^^] [ответить]  
  • +/
    А промолчать нельзя было ? Тут народ старательно игнорит, нет надо было об этом сказать.. что за люди
     

  • 1.46, Аноним (49), 23:46, 11/03/2021 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    NetBeans не такой тормоз как IDEA
     

     Добавить комментарий
    Имя:
    E-Mail:
    Текст:
    При перепечатке указание ссылки на opennet.ru обязательно



    Спонсоры:
    Inferno Solutions
    Hosting by Hoster.ru
    Хостинг:

    Закладки на сайте
    Проследить за страницей
    Created 1996-2021 by Maxim Chirkov
    Добавить, Поддержать, Вебмастеру